Biography

Miss Sofina Begum is a consultant thoracic surgeon at Royal Brompton Hospital, where she treats private and NHS patients.

She received her medical degree from the University of Leicester in 2004. During that time she finished an intercalated BSc in cardiovascular science and went on to complete her basic surgical training in London.

Miss Begum achieved her master’s in surgical science and then went on to higher surgical training in Yorkshire. She has completed training in uniportal (keyhole) minimally invasive surgery for lung cancer and lung volume reduction. She is also trained in endobronchial procedures for airway disease and severe emphysema.

Since 2017, Miss Begum has been a consultant at Royal Brompton Hospital and is the lead thoracic surgeon for the London Sarcoma Service. She is an examiner for the Joint Royal College of Surgeons FRCSCTH examinations and a member of the Specialist Training Committee for cardiothoracic surgery in London.
